K052532 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the IMAX 9.5 STERILIZERS. Classified as Sterilizer, Steam (product code FLE), Class II - Special Controls.

Submitted by Dental X Srl (North Attleboro,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on September 5, 2006 after a review of 355 days - an unusually long review period, suggesting complex equivalence evaluation.

This device falls under the General Hospital F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 880.6880 - the FDA general hospital device fram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.
